Ingredients


– 1 pound ground beef (preferably lean)
– 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 small onion, finely chopped
– 1 bell pepper, diced
– 1 carrot, grated
– 1 cup mushrooms, finely chopped
– 3 tablespoons soy sauce
– 1 tablespoon hoisin sauce
– 1 tablespoon oyster sauce (optional)
– 1 teaspoon sesame oil
– 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
– Fresh green onions, chopped (for garnish)
– Lettuce leaves (such as iceberg or romaine)
– Sriracha or chili sauce (for serving)

Step-by-Step Instructions


Creating Asian-Style Ground Beef Lettuce Wraps is simple if you follow these steps closely:
1. Heat the Oil: In a large skillet, heat vegetable oil over medium-high heat.
2. Cook the Beef: Add the ground beef, breaking it up with a spatula. Cook until browned, about 5-7 minutes.
3. Add Aromatics: Stir in the minced garlic, chopped onion, and grated ginger.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until the onions are translucent.
4. Incorporate Vegetables: Add the diced bell pepper, grated carrot, and chopped mushrooms to the skillet. Stir-fry for about 5 minutes until softened.
5. Season the Mixture: Pour in the soy sauce, hoisin sauce, oyster sauce (if using), and sesame oil. Mix everything thoroughly and let simmer for 2-3 minutes until heated through.
6. Adjust the Flavor: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ary, adding extra soy sauce or spices to your liking.
7. Prepare the Lettuce: While the beef mixture is cooking, rinse the lettuce leaves and pat them dry. Set aside.
8. Assemble the Wraps: Spoon the beef mixture into each lettuce leaf, filling them generously.
9. Garnish: Top the wraps with chopped green onions and a drizzle of Sriracha for spice.
10. Serve Warm: Plate your lettuce wraps and serve immediately.

Additional Tips


– Use Fresh Lettuce: For the best wraps, select crisp and fresh lettuce leaves. Iceberg or romaine are great choices for their strength.
– Customize the Protein: Feel free to substitute ground beef with ground turkey, chicken, or even tofu for a vegetarian option.
– Create a Sauce Bar: Offer a variety of sauces for guests to mix into their filling, such as teriyaki, hoisin, or hot sauce.
– Add Crunch: Incorporating chopped nuts, such as peanuts or cashews, can add a delightful crunch to your wraps.
– Spice Levels: Adjust the heat level by adding more Sriracha or incorporating diced jalapeños into the beef mixture.

Recipe Variation


Here are a few tasty variations to consider:
1. Pineapple Addition: Add crushed pineapple to the beef mixture for a sweet and tangy flavor twist.
2. Asian Slaw: Mix shredded cabbage, carrots, and a light dressing to use inside the wraps for an added crunch.
3. Bold Flavors: Incorporate different spices like five-spice powder or chili garlic sauce to create unique flavor profiles.
4. Herb-Infused: Try adding fresh cilantro or basil to your beef mixture for a burst of herby flavor.
5. Vegan Version: Substitute the ground beef with a plant-based meat alternative or a mixture of quinoa and mushrooms.

Freezing and Storage


Storage: Keep the prepared beef filling in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Freezing: The beef mixture can also be frozen for up to 2 months. Just reheat thoroughly before serving.
Lettuce Storage: Store leftover lettuce in the refrigerator, wrapped in a damp paper towel, to keep it crisp.

Frequently Asked Questions


Can I make the beef mixture 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the beef mixture a day in advance. Just reheat before serving.
What type of lettuce works best?
Iceberg and romaine are popular choices because they offer a sturdy structure and crisp texture.
Is there a gluten-free option for this dish?
Absolutely! Use gluten-free soy sauce or tamari as a substitute for regular soy sauce.
How can I make the wraps more filling?
Consider adding shredded carrots, chopped bell peppers, or avocado slices to the wraps for added volume and nutrients.
What can I serve with these lettuce wraps?
They pair well with steamed rice, vegetable stir-fry, or a light salad.
